Abstract

Traumatic brain injury is a mechanical trauma to the head, either directly or indirectly, which causes impaired neurological function, namely physical, cognitive, psychosocial functioning, both temporarily and permanently. Traumatic brain injury is a very complex disease. Currently, there is no effective treatment that can reduce the effects of the primary injury, only therapy that can inhibit its development. Interventions to improve the quality of life of traumatic brain injury patients used to include drug treatment, surgery, and rehabilitation therapy have had poor results. The recent clinical use of stem cells as a possible therapeutic application. Stem cell therapy is used in regenerative medicine to restore damaged neurons. Stem cell is a cell that exhibits a multipotent capacity to differentiate into different cell types and has the capacity for self-renewal. In different preclinical studies, conducted in animal models of traumatic brain injury, stem cell transplantation has led to improvements in several neurological parameters. Mesenchymal stem cell therapy is one of the most potent and attractive options for regenerative therapy of traumatic brain injury. This therapy has shown its potential in clinical aspects. Although there is much basic research on traumatic brain injury, especially on the complex pathophysiology and applicability of stem cell therapy, there are still many issues that need to be resolved to determine the best method for recovery of brain function.
